As of 2026-04-03, Coca Cola Femsa S.A.B. de C.V. American Depositary Shares each representing 10 Units (each Unit consists of 3 Series B Shares and 5 Series L Shares) (KOF) are trading at $98.76, marking a 0.19% decline in recent session activity. This analysis outlines key technical levels, current market context, and potential near-term scenarios for KOF, amid mixed performance across the broader consumer staples sector.
